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
803903 2020024724 96308113048
1950664 367
1950664 367
56 252 196696 2506
All about undefined
Interested in learning more?
1950664 367
56 252 196696 2506
See more
9437988936 522063573 282944086
56 064715 860971 28514
See more
492087627 8487209
8064718 8889029 600124229 0621682
See more